A reasonable estimate of the current range is: Grade: Professional 308 Pay Range: $73,000.00 - $109,400.00 Job Description The Marketing Manager is responsible for the execution of marketing strategies that support brand development, new student growth, and other priorities for their assigned academic college (College of Business, College of Health Professions, College of IT, or Teachers College). Among the Manager’s responsibilities is launching audience and offering messages and growth strategies that are college-specific (i.e., “product marketing”). The Manager will work with the Director to understand internal and external factors that affect college performance including the evolving portfolio of academic course and program offerings, industry associations and employer partnerships, target audiences, market demand trends, and competitor behavior. The Manager works in daily partnership with associate deans and program chairs within their assigned college to understand program goals and targets, develop campaigns and placements to support program strategies, execute on college-specific initiatives, and report on results. The Manager will spend more time interfacing and collaborating with members of the Marketing team and must build trust and wield strong influence within the organization. This role requires a driving action through influence vs. direct authority, as well as fluency in various marketing disciplines, including brand, traditional and digital media, SEO, content marketing, conference and event marketing, and more.
